Box Score BANNER ELK, NC - The men's volleyball team took on the Lees-McRae Bobcats on Saturday afternoon. The Lions defeated the Bobcats in 5 sets, 3-2. The victory moves the Lions' record to 7-12 overall and 5-8 in conference play.
The first set began with the Bobcats taking control as they gained a five point lead, 11-6. Lees-McRae continued to hold the momentum until the score was 20-14. A 6-1 run from the Lions kept their hopes of winning the set alive as they got within one, 21-20. However, with the score 24-23, a kill from the Bobcats gave them the first set, 25-23.
The second set began with three straight points from the Lions. The early momentum for Emmanuel propelled them to a six point lead, 10-4. With the score at 14-10, a 5-1 run gave the Lions their largest lead of the set, 19-11. The run included an ace and a kill from freshman Carlos Guerrero, two kills from sophomore setter Henrik Westhoff, and a kill from senior Don Thompson. The Bobcats proceeded to score five straight, but their effort came up short as the Lions took the second set, 25-19.
The Bobcats rebounded early in the third set, taking a 7-3 lead. The Lions rallied to tie the score at 10 points. With the Bobcats leading 18-16, the Lions scored four straight points as Guerrero and Westhoff each recorded a kill and Thompson had a service ace. With the score tied at 21, a kill from the Bobcats gave them a one point advantage. Thompson responded with a kill, but it wasn't enough as 3 more points for the Bobcats gave them the set, 25-23.
The Lions took the lead early in the fourth set, 10-5. The scoring proceeded to seesaw back and forth until the Lions still held a five point lead late, 20-15. The Bobcats fought their way back to just a two point defecit, 21-19. However, a kill from sophomore Jayden Young was followed by an error from the Bobcats and a kill from senior Aleksa Lakic, getting the Lions to set point. Guerrero finished off the run with a kill that gave the Lions the fourth set, 25-19.
The Lions led 4-2 to begin the fifth and final set. The Bobcats scored two in a row to tie the score at four points. Back to back kills for Guerrero led to a three point lead for the Lions, 11-8. A kill from Thompson got Emmanuel within three of taking the game, but two consecutive points kept the Bobcats' hopes alive as they narrowed the deficit to one point. A kill for Lakic got the Lions to set point, but the Bobcats responded to extend the set. A kill from Thompson once again gave Emmanuel the advantage, but Lees-McRae once again responded to tie the set at 15. An error from the Bulldogs put the game in the hands of Thompson, who was up to serve. The senior stepped up with the game on the line and finished off the Bobcats with an ace that gave the Lions the set, 17-15, and the game, 3-2.
The Lions were led by Don Thompson, who recorded a double-double with 19 kills, 10 digs, 4 blocks, and 2 service aces. Aleksa Lakic finished with 17 kills, 7 digs, and an ace. Carlos Guerrero had a career high 13 kills and a career high hitting percentage of .632, along with 4 blocks and an ace.
Setter Henrik Westhoff recorded a double-double with 55 assists and 12 digs. Westhoff also had a career high of 8 kills and a hitting percentage of .571 to go along with 4 blocks and an ace.
